Why Proper Prep Ensures a Lasting Paint Job

Surface preparation is crucial for the success of any painting project. When it comes to exterior painting, preparing surfaces properly can make all the difference between a long-lasting finish and one that peels or fades quickly. This process involves cleaning, sanding, and priming, ensuring the paint adheres well and withstands weather conditions. A well-prepared surface improves not only durability but also enhances aesthetics, making your property look fresh and inviting.

The Role of Cleaning in Surface Preparation

Cleaning is the first step in the surface preparation process. Dirt, dust, and grime must be removed to allow the paint to stick properly. Using a power washer can effectively clean large areas, removing years of buildup that might interfere with paint adhesion. For smaller spaces or delicate materials, scrub brushes and mild detergents may be more appropriate.

Dealing With Old Paint Layers

Before applying new paint, it’s essential to assess existing paint layers. Flaking or loose paint should be scraped off completely. Sanding may be required to smooth rough areas and provide a suitable texture for the new coat. This attention to detail during surface preparation significantly impacts the longevity of your exterior home painting.

Sanding: Achieving a Smooth Finish

Sanding is a critical part of surface preparation. It helps create an even surface by smoothing out imperfections and ensuring better paint adhesion. Use sandpaper or electric sanders based on the scope of the job. Remember, proper sanding not only enhances appearance but also prevents future peeling or bubbling.

The Importance of Priming

Applying primer is a vital step that cannot be overlooked. Primer serves as a base that seals pores in the material and adds an extra layer of protection against moisture and stains. It also helps ensure that paint colors remain vibrant and even across the surface. Selecting the right primer depends on the type of material you are painting; consult experts if unsure.

Common Mistakes in Surface Preparation

Avoiding common mistakes in preparation can save time and resources. One frequent error is neglecting to clean surfaces thoroughly, which leads to poor adhesion. Skipping sanding can result in uneven finishes. Additionally, not using primer increases the likelihood of color inconsistencies and reduces paint lifespan.

Best Practices for Successful Painting Projects

To achieve the best results in painting, follow these expert recommendations:

  • Always start with a clean surface.
  • Remove old paint layers that are flaking or damaged.
  • Sand all surfaces evenly before application.
  • Select primers specifically designed for your materials.
  • Follow manufacturer’s instructions on drying times between coats.
